A – Fondant (also known as Sugar paste) is what gives the smooth look on a cake. It is an edible frosting that is usually placed over a covering of Buttercream. It provides more stability and acts as a sealant to the cake especially during hot days. In years past, fondant was not a welcome taste to the palate. Because we do place a layering of Buttercream underneath our fondant cakes, if you have guests that do not like the taste it can be easily peeled away. You can still have the great look of fondant without losing the great taste! .
